ALEXANDRIA, Va., April 7 -- United States Patent no. 12,598,726, issued on April 7, was assigned to Vitesco Technologies Germany GmbH (Regensberg, Germany).

"Control module for a vehicle with at least an electric motor and a transmission" was invented by Alexander Wenk (Burgoberbach, Germany), Peter Schroll (Nuremberg, Germany), Karl Maron (Heroldsberg, Germany), Simon Kim (Nuremberg, Germany), Cornel Mariutiu (Nuremberg, Germany), Jurgen Sauerbier (Dachsbach, Germany) and Yvonne Wiegand (Mainstockheim, Germany).
